Output 31f48d9927557de56e03a51b4bc734b338b612eb41aec7069ce7baeb0d6159ba:1

value
16622
script pubkey
OP_0 OP_PUSHBYTES_20 ecf500fb7d4c3724180368dcf116ad360b42e11d
address
bc1qan6sp7mafsmjgxqrdrw0z94dxc959cgaklyg7s
transaction
31f48d9927557de56e03a51b4bc734b338b612eb41aec7069ce7baeb0d6159ba
spent
false